“The Searcher’s Ballad” by Lior Holzman

“The Searcher’s Ballad” is about the perspective you gain after traveling on your own and searching for the deeper moments of yourself. This song is insanely well portrayed by Lior Holzman, including many moments of reflection for the listener within the storytelling.

The emotion and subtle vocal change is how this song really works so well. Lior Holzman has a consistent and particular sound that he stays true to.

I loved the sultry feeling from start to finish.
